Candlewood Suites Cleveland-North Olmsted

24741 Country Club Blvd
North Olmsted, Ohio 44070
16.0 miles from St. Timothy's Church
More hotels near this hotel


Directions from Candlewood Suites Cleveland-North Olmsted to St. Timothy's Church


More North Olmsted Landmarks Near Candlewood Suites Cleveland-North Olmsted

Rocky River Nature Ctr (0.6 miles)